Additional information

Two Daphnia study for Betaines, C12-14 (even numbered)-alkyldimethyl, EC No. 931-700-2 are available. Both studies are conducted according to OECD 202. Garcia (2008) revealed EC50 values between 5.3 (C12-Betaine) and 48 mg/L (C10-Betaine), depending on the chain lengh. The test was conducted with 100 % active substance. The EC50 value of the study from Vandendaele (2010) is in the same range providing an EC50 of 7.76 mg/L.
